- Identify Your Skills and Interests: Start by identifying your skills, talents, and interests. Determine what you enjoy doing and what you excel at. This self-awareness will help you choose side hustles that align with your strengths and bring you fulfillment.
- Research Market Demand: Conduct market research to identify side hustle opportunities that have a high demand. Look for gaps in the market or emerging trends where your skills can be leveraged. Consider factors such as target audience, competition, and potential profitability.
- Choose the Right Side Hustle: Based on your skills and market research, select a side hustle that resonates with you. Common side hustles include freelancing, tutoring, pet sitting, driving for rideshare services, creating and selling crafts, virtual assistance, and online tutoring. Choose one or more side hustles that match your interests and available time.
- Set Realistic Goals: Set clear and realistic goals for your side hustle. Define how much money you want to earn, the time commitment you can dedicate, and the timeline for achieving your goals. Having specific targets will keep you focused and motivated.
- Manage Your Time Effectively: Balancing a side hustle with other responsibilities requires effective time management. Create a schedule that allows you to allocate dedicated time for your side hustle. Prioritize tasks, set deadlines, and eliminate distractions to maximize your productivity.
- Market Yourself: Promote your side hustle by building a strong personal brand. Create a professional online presence through a website, social media profiles, or a portfolio showcasing your work. Utilize word-of-mouth referrals, networking, and online platforms to reach potential clients or customers.
- Provide Exceptional Service: Deliver outstanding customer service and quality work in your side hustle. Exceed expectations and go the extra mile to build a positive reputation. Happy customers or clients are more likely to recommend you and provide repeat business.
- Continuous Learning and Improvement: Invest in your personal and professional development to enhance your side hustle. Stay updated with industry trends, learn new skills, and seek feedback from clients or customers. Continuous learning and improvement will help you stay competitive and provide better value to your clients.
- Financial Management: Effectively manage the income generated from your side hustle. Create a separate bank account for your side hustle earnings to keep your personal and business finances separate. Track your expenses, set aside money for taxes, and maintain proper financial records.
- Evaluate and Expand: Regularly evaluate the performance of your side hustle. Assess your progress, income, and customer satisfaction. Identify areas for improvement and consider expanding your side hustle by offering additional services, targeting new markets, or exploring new revenue streams.
